About the Role:
We are seeking a skilled and creative Content Writer to join our local media team on a part-time basis for a temporary 3-month contract. This role is ideal for a writer with a passion for storytelling, local news, and community business features.

Key Responsibilities:

Conduct interviews with local business owners and community figures (via email or phone).

Write engaging articles based on these interviews for publication on our website and in our digital magazines.

Cover a mix of local news and business-related stories that resonate with our regional audience.

Maintain clear communication with editors and ensure deadlines are met.

Adapt tone and style for different platforms as needed.

What We're Looking For:

Strong writing and interviewing skills.

Ability to create accurate, engaging, and well-structured articles.

Interest in local affairs and small business development.

Experience writing for digital platforms (preferred).

Self-motivated and comfortable working independently.
